I am over 65 and filed with the 1040SR form last year. This year TTax did not generate the 1040-SR form, only the worksheet. It has created only the 1040. Is this a mistake? Did I do something wrong? Do I need to be concerned about filing the 1040 regular form?
You'll need to sign in or create an account to connect with an expert.
No reason for concern at all. If you print the return it will print on a 1040SR for you. The 1040 and 1040SR are identical. All of the lines and all of the calculations are exactly the same. The difference is that the 1040SR prints out with bigger print and goes to a third page. There is no difference whatsoever in your refund or tax due.
